Output 52b1382d71b028f835fe13a9ff87db0e52d8b6039a39a5c3f6774320571a6b80:18

value
58155944
script pubkey
OP_0 OP_PUSHBYTES_20 3ba7a6d67f6a51eab9dcfb1711075119d085259e
address
bc1q8wn6d4nldfg74wwulvt3zp63r8gg2fv7wdy8kv
transaction
52b1382d71b028f835fe13a9ff87db0e52d8b6039a39a5c3f6774320571a6b80
spent
true